Things to do near Serdang

Shopping

In Serdang, visit the vibrant The Mines Shopping Mall, featuring a mix of retail shops and dining options. If you're up for a drive, approximately 19km away, head to Sunway Pyramid, a large shopping destination known for its unique architecture and variety of international brands.

Recreation

Experience rejuvenation at the Wellness Spa Serdang, where you can indulge in soothing massages and holistic treatments. Complement your relaxation with a stroll in the nearby Taman Tasik Perdana, enjoying the tranquil lakes and lush greenery, perfect for unwinding after your spa visit.

Adventure

The Sepang International Circuit, located 24km from Serdang, offers exhilarating motor racing experiences amidst a vibrant atmosphere. For a scenic adventure, take the Genting Skyway cable car, situated 48km away, providing stunning views. Alternatively, SkyTrex Adventure, 27km from Serdang, features an exciting zipline ropes course for thrill-seekers.

Nightlife

Serdang's nightlife offers a lively atmosphere with diverse options. Visit the bustling Sunway Pyramid for shopping and dining, or unwind at local cafes like Cafe 88 for a laid-back vibe. For a vibrant scene, check out the nearby Titiwangsa Lake Gardens, perfect for evening strolls and relaxation.

*Distances are measured in a straight line; actual driving distances may vary depending on the route.

Best time to go to Serdang

The best time to visit Serdang can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Serdang falls in May, when vis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ature in Serdang falls in January and December. December has slightly high visitor numbers and mostly cloudy weather.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January78.4°F (25.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
February79.3°F (26.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March80.2°F (26.8°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April80.6°F (27.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
May81.0°F (27.2°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
June80.6°F (27.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
July80.4°F (26.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
August80.4°F (26.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September80.1°F (26.7°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
October80.1°F (26.7°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
November79.0°F (26.1°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December78.4°F (25.8°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Serdang

Flying into Serdang, Selangor, is convenient with nearby airports such as Kuala Lumpur International Airport (KUL), located 26km away. Excellent hotels near KUL include Mövenpick Hotel & Convention Centre KLIA, 5km away, and DoubleTree by Hilton Putrajaya Lakeside, 16km away, both offering various transportation services. Subang Airport (SZB), situated 23km from Serdang, has notable options like Traders Hotel Kuala Lumpur and Hilton Kuala Lumpur, both within 16km, providing shuttle services. For those considering Malacca International Airport (MKZ), located 100km away, Hatten Hotel Melaka and Doubletree by Hilton Melaka are ideal, just 5 to 10km from the airport.
